Tumble & Multiplier: The Chain Reaction
Once a win is confirmed, the matching symbols vanish and new ones drop down from above. That’s where the game’s high volatility truly plays out: one win can lead to five more wins in rapid succession if the new symbols line up again.
The real kicker is the multiplier orb that can land anywhere on any reel. These orbs range from 2× up to an eye‑popping 500× and are added together at the end of each tumble cycle.
- Green orbs: typically low multipliers but appear frequently.
- Red orbs: high risk but offer the biggest payoff.

The Progressive Multiplier
During free spins, every multiplier orb that lands on a winning spin adds its value to a running total multiplier. This total multiplier persists throughout the free spin round and multiplies every subsequent win that involves an orb. The effect can be dramatic—turning what would be a modest payout into something unforgettable.
